まとめ
音と形を結びつける ブーバ・キキ効果は 整体的なものではありません 混合刺激におけるその強さは,その部分の合計から予測できます.
科学分野:
- 認知科学
- 心理言語学
- クロスモダル認識
背景:
- ブーバ・キキ効果は 発話された音と視覚的形状の 交差関係を示しています
- この効果は通常,丸い形状を"ブーバ"のような音と,角形の形状を"キキ"のような音と結びつけます.
- この効果が混合的な特徴を持つ刺激にどのように適用されるかを理解することは極めて重要です.
研究 の 目的:
- ブーバ・キキ効果が統合的か構成的に作用するかを調べる.
- 複合的な形状や単語への影響が 構成部分から予測できるかどうかを判断する.
主な方法:
- "ブーバ"や"キキ"のような形や言葉の標準化
- 両方のタイプの特徴を組み合わせて,複合的な形状と単語を作成します.
- 構成部分に基づく複合刺激に対するブーバ・キキ効果の強さを予測する統計分析.
主要な成果:
- ブーバ・キキ効果の強さは 複合的な形状や言葉の個々の部分の 線形的合計によって正確に予測されました
- 効果の総合的な説明ではなく 構成的な説明を強く支持する証拠がある.
結論:
- ブーバ・キキ効果は 構成現象として最もよく理解されます
- この発見は 形と音の交差に関する理解を簡素化し 総合的な解釈に挑戦します

In 1928, a German botanist Emil Heitz observed the moss nuclei with a DNA binding dye. He observed that while some chromatin regions decondense and spread out in the interphase nucleus, others do not. He termed them euchromatin and heterochromatin, respectively. He proposed that the heterochromatin regions reflect a functionally inactive state of the genome. It was later confirmed that heterochromatin is transcriptionally repressed, and euchromatin is transcriptionally active chromatin.
